The cheat book. Vol. 1

£8.99

Forgotten your homework and need to WING it? Wish you could talk your way out of DETENTION? Want to SQUASH your bullies and RISE to the top? Join Kamal as he attempts to go from PUKE BOY to POPULAR! Kamal is better than anyone else in his school at fading into the background. When you’re a refugee and you’ve started a new school three times in as many years, you learn to keep your head down. But, after a major puke incident in front of the whole school, being invisible is no longer an option. And when Kamal finds a mysterious CHEAT BOOK in the library that promises to help him gain popularity, he sees a chance to finally make his mark.

The Summer Reading Challenge has officially started! 
All your child has to do is collect a booklet from your local bookshop or library and choose 6 summer reading goals!📚
For every goal they complete, return to your bookshop/library to receive a sticker. Once your child has all 6 stickers by the end of September they will then earn a certificate!!!🌟
This year we want to celebrate the connection between music and storytelling, encouraging children to discover stories, creativity and rhythm through books.⁠ 🎵
